Subject: Partner SFTP drop — new owner

Hi,

As you review the pending changes to the Harborline ingest scripts, note that ownership of the partner SFTP drop is changing at the end of the month. This includes key rotation, the nightly pull job, and the quarantine folder for malformed files. Review comments on the retry logic should still go through the normal PR flow, but questions about drop-folder conventions or partner onboarding now go to the new owner. The incoming owner is listed below.

signatory, tagaf-bahaf: Praael Fenmir Rusok

// MIN_CONTRAST_RATIO: floor enforced after the Lumen Kit
// color-contrast audit. Values below 4.5:1 failed review for
// body text across all Brightvale themes. Do not lower this
// constant without a fresh audit pass; the check runs at
// theme compile time, not render time. The audit was
// performed against the build whose token appears below.

trace token, tawep-fahif: htk3_b58

Step 4: Deploying the Quillrender PDF invoice service. Before pushing the build to the Fennwick staging cluster, verify that the font bundle checksum matches the manifest, since mismatched glyph tables have silently corrupted invoice totals before. Once the checksum passes, register the artifact with the deploy broker. Use the deploy key below, scoped to staging only.

release key, kawif-hawep: bky13_X7TGuRG4Zu4ZJ

// This module was extracted from the Farrowgate monolith's user
// subsystem during the Q3 decomposition. Profile reads now go through
// the Lintwell cache layer; writes still round-trip to the legacy
// store until migration completes. Keep these constants in sync with
// the values in the monolith's user_config until the old path is
// deleted, or dual-reads will diverge. Future maintainers should not
// raise the batch sizes without load-testing the legacy store first.
// The tuning constants are defined immediately below.

constants for tafog-kahag:
RATE_LIMITS = {
    "sorir": 697,
    "oliox": 683,
    "holax": 176,
    "casox": 60,
    "pelius": 382,
}